Christopher Nolan
Christopher Nolan is the defining blockbuster auteur of his generation, directing 12 feature films since 1998 that collectively earned over $5 billion worldwide, with Oppenheimer (2023) winning his first Best Director Oscar and grossing $952 million—more than double the typical biopic average. Nolan's signature non-linear storytelling and practical effects, exemplified by the 20-minute IMAX sequence in Dunkirk, have influenced every major franchise director since.
